    Default Called a raise in pos AJs in pos flop is J high - now what?

    Ajs & KQs are losing money for me over the last 50k hands, I think because I had been 3betting them in pos & then overplaying
    tp without at least tk.
    In this situation there was a raise from 20/15 utg, co calls & I elected just to call otb with Ajs, flop is J high and pfr raiser cbets.

    (Oh and I play a 60bb stack when starting at a table - no crits on that please.)

    Quote Originally Posted by martindcx1e
    Quote Originally Posted by Andypandy
    Fwiw i often 3-bet here pf (I'm running 19/14).
    why? is just bc of the caller or do you just like 3betting utg raisers with AJs?
    Often, not always.
    Ofc u have to adjust to how much the pfr adjust his openingrange according to his position, but i think we often are good vs his range and additionally have FE. If he opens all pairs from utg (these will be a large chunk of his raising hands here) and (mistakenly) calls our rr just for setvalue, we can take down the pot with a cbet. The coldcaller brings more money in the pot which make taking down the pot pf quite sweet.
